Package problem.



I have a problem with the package system.  We use mysql compiled
straight from the original source-tarball.  We've also installed
libdb-mysql-perl which depends on mysql-base.  Because of this unmet
dependency, apt refuses to do anything.

Is it possible to make dpkg think it has installed mysql-base without
actually doing it?  Or install it without overwriting the current
mysql installation?

Thanks for any guidance -- it's really no option to install mysql from
a package.
